MATTER OF ABREU v. BELLAMY

508625.

81 A.D.3d 1004 (2011)

916 N.Y.S.2d 851

In the Matter of CARLOS ABREU, Appellant, v. KAREN BELLAMY, as Director of Inmate Grievance Program, et al., Respondents.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Third Department.

Decided February 3, 2011.


Petitioner, a prison inmate, filed 120 grievances in the first 75 days of his incarceration at Attica Correctional Facility in Wyoming County and refused to make any accommodations to decrease the number of filings. As a result, respondent Director of Inmate Grievance Program informed him that his actions were an abuse of the system and that he was, thereafter, limited to the filing of two grievances per week, each limited to a single issue.
